1. The Rise of Ethical Hackers

Ethical hackers, also known as white hat hackers or penetration testers, are cybersecurity professionals who use their expertise to identify and fix security vulnerabilities within an organization's systems. They adopt the same techniques as malicious hackers but employ them ethically and with permission. By simulating cyberattacks, ethical hackers help organizations understand their security weaknesses and develop robust defense strategies.

2. Addressing the Growing Cybersecurity Demand

The demand for ethical hackers has witnessed an unprecedented surge. A report by Cybersecurity Ventures predicts a 350% increase in global demand for cybersecurity professionals by 2021. This surge is primarily driven by the growing sophistication of cyberattacks and a heightened awareness of the significance of cybersecurity.

3. Safeguarding Critical Infrastructure

Critical infrastructure, such as power grids and water treatment plants, has increasingly become a target for cybercriminals. Recent high-profile cyberattacks have exposed vulnerabilities in these vital systems, highlighting the need for strengthened cybersecurity measures. Ethical hackers play a pivotal role in this domain, assisting organizations in safeguarding their critical infrastructure by identifying vulnerabilities and implementing security measures.

4. Ethical Hacking Career Preparation

If you aspire to pursue a career in ethical hacking, there are essential steps to follow:

a) Learn About Ethical Hacking

Begin your journey by gaining knowledge about different types of cyberattacks and the methodologies employed by hackers. There are numerous resources available, such as books, online courses, and boot camps, to provide you with the necessary skills.

b) Obtain Certifications

Acquiring certifications in ethical hacking will strengthen your credibility and showcase your skills to potential employers. Several renowned certifications, such as Certified Ethical Hacker (CEH), are widely recognized in the industry.

c) Gain Practical Experience

To truly excel in ethical hacking, hands-on experience is crucial. Volunteer to assist local organizations with their cybersecurity needs or secure an entry-level position in the field to gain practical knowledge.

d) Network with the Ethical Hacking Community

Networking with fellow ethical hackers is invaluable. Engage with online and offline communities to learn from others, discover job opportunities, and stay updated on the latest trends in ethical hacking.

FAQs About Ethical Hacking

1. What is the main difference between ethical hackers and malicious hackers?

Ethical hackers use their skills for the benefit of organizations by identifying and fixing security vulnerabilities with permission, while malicious hackers engage in cyberattacks with malicious intent.

2. How can ethical hackers contribute to critical infrastructure protection?

Ethical hackers help identify and address security weaknesses in critical infrastructure systems, preventing potential cyberattacks that could have severe consequences.

3. Is ethical hacking a growing field for career opportunities?

Yes, the demand for ethical hackers is rapidly increasing, providing ample job opportunities and career growth prospects.

4. What certifications are essential for aspiring ethical hackers?

Certifications like Certified Ethical Hacker (CEH) and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P) are highly regarded in the ethical hacking community.
